U.S. Hispanic purchasing power has surged to nearly $700 billion and is projected to reach as much as $1 trillion by 2010, according to new estimates by HispanTelligence.

In addition, according to eMarketer, there will be over 13 million Hispanic Internet users in the US by the end of the year, up from 12.4 million in 2003. The number of Hispanic Internet users is expected to reach 16 million by 2007. Another study by Roslow Research Group, supporting Hispanics using a major purchase matching service like SuAyuda, concluded that over 70 percent of Hispanic Internet users polled in the study said they plan to use the web in their car purchasing process and 84 percent would be more likely to do their automotive shopping and research online if they could do so in Spanish.
